One of the most interesting debates at Workers Liberty’s ‘Ideas for Freedom’ event this weekend was the debate on Israel-Palestine. Camilla Bassi spoke for Workers Liberty and, imho, wiped the floor with the guy from WP – but I would say that wouldn’t I?

The WP speaker was, however,  interesting for a number of reasons, not least because he started out by stating that he didn’t reject the idea of two states, or indeed a “Jewish state” in principle; but the present state of Israel is “not legitimate”, though he never explained what he meant by that.

But most interesting (and worrying) was his reference to  ”the tendentious  historiography of European anti-Semitism and the holocaust” that the Israeli state (allegedly) uses. 

Any suggestions as to what exactly he could possibly have meant by this?

  14. James Bloodworth said,

    “The WP speaker was, however, interesting for a number of reasons, not least because he started out by stating that he didn’t reject the idea of…a “Jewish state” in principle;”

    I fail to see what is wrong with a rejection of a “Jewish state” “in principle” as opposed to a state for Jews. Is it not possible to reject the idea of all religious states, without having to face the accusation that one is somehow anti-Jew?

    Israel has not always been about the construction of a “Jewish state”, and in the past had many important Jewish advocates who took the far more admirable secular position of bulding Israel as a state for the Jews as opposed to a religiously-based entity.
